Abstract
The present invention proposes a kind of yellow-feather broiler mixed feed, and according to the number of parts by weight, including following raw material is made:5~10 parts of 400~600 parts of corn, 100~150 parts of dregs of beans, 60~120 parts of rice bran meal, 50~100 parts of earthworm tunning, 10~30 parts of vegetable oil, 50~100 parts of peanut meal, 1~3 part of compound amino acid, 2~4 parts of complex enzyme, 1~2 part of trace element, 0.5~1 part of phytase and calcium monohydrogen phosphate;Wherein, the earthworm tunning is to first pass through after Lactobacillus casei ferments with lactobacillus acidophilus to be filtered after fermentation of bacillus subtilis again as raw material using earthworm, obtains filtrate, then be concentrated and dried.The feed improves protein utilization rate, and the meat nutrition of broiler chicken is enriched.

The content of the invention
The present invention proposes a kind of yellow-feather broiler mixed feed, and the feed improves protein utilization rate, and causes the meat of broiler chicken
Matter is nutritious.
The technical proposal of the invention is realized in this way:
A kind of yellow-feather broiler mixed feed, according to the number of parts by weight, including following raw material is made:
400~600 parts of corn, 100~150 parts of dregs of beans, 60~120 parts of rice bran meal, 50~100 parts of earthworm tunning,
10~30 parts of vegetable oil, 50~100 parts of peanut meal, 1~3 part of compound amino acid, 2~4 parts of complex enzyme, trace element 1~2 part,
5~10 parts of 0.5~1 part of phytase and calcium monohydrogen phosphate;Wherein, the earthworm tunning is to first pass through cheese by raw material of earthworm
Lactobacillus is filtered after fermentation of bacillus subtilis again after being fermented with lactobacillus acidophilus, obtains filtrate, then be concentrated and dried
.
Preferably, the specific preparation method of the earthworm tunning:
Water defibrination process is added after being first frozen into powder with liquid nitrogen as raw material using earthworm, earthworm slurry is obtained, is then inoculated with cheese
Lactobacillus is fermented with lactobacillus acidophilus at a temperature of 22 DEG C~27 DEG C, fermentation time 12h~24h, then inoculates withered grass
Bacillus is fermented at a temperature of 20 DEG C~24 DEG C, fermentation time 24h~36h, then stops fermentation, and zymotic fluid is filtered,
Filtrate is obtained, then is concentrated and dried.
Preferably, the Lactobacillus casei and the total addition level of lactobacillus acidophilus for earthworm powder weight 0.1~
0.3%, the addition of the bacillus subtilis is the 0.1~0.3% of earthworm powder weight.
Preferably, the compound amino acid is methionine, threonine, the mixture with lysine.
Preferably, the complex enzyme is by cellulase, 1,4 beta-glucanase, zytase, alpha-amylase, beta-mannase
A variety of and carrier shell powder in enzyme, carbohydrase, acid protease combines.
Preferably, the trace element is by ferrous sulfate, zinc sulfate, copper sulphate, manganese sulfate, calcium iodate, sodium selenite, chlorine
A variety of and as carrier the stone flours changed in cobalt combine.
The preparation method of the yellow-feather broiler mixed feed of the present invention:
Various components in formula are put into mixer, are well mixed, 60-80 mesh sieves are crossed after crushing, then pass through granulation
Mechanism grain or powder directly pack.Can be by the product of the present invention according to the feed intake Direct-fed of broiler chicken during use.

Embodiment
Embodiment 1
The specific preparation method of earthworm tunning:
Water defibrination process is added after being first frozen into powder with liquid nitrogen as raw material using earthworm, earthworm slurry is obtained, is then inoculated with cheese
Lactobacillus is fermented with lactobacillus acidophilus at a temperature of 22 DEG C, fermentation time 24h, then inoculates bacillus subtilis 24
Fermented at a temperature of DEG C, fermentation time 24h, then stop fermentation, zymotic fluid is filtered, and obtains filtrate, then be concentrated and dried.
Lactobacillus casei and the total addition level of lactobacillus acidophilus are the 0.1% of earthworm powder weight, and the addition of bacillus subtilis is
The 0.3% of earthworm powder weight.
Embodiment 2
The specific preparation method of earthworm tunning:
Water defibrination process is added after being first frozen into powder with liquid nitrogen as raw material using earthworm, earthworm slurry is obtained, is then inoculated with cheese
Lactobacillus is fermented with lactobacillus acidophilus at a temperature of 27 DEG C, fermentation time 12h, then inoculates bacillus subtilis 20
Fermented at a temperature of DEG C, fermentation time 36h, then stop fermentation, zymotic fluid is filtered, and obtains filtrate, then be concentrated and dried.
Lactobacillus casei and the total addition level of lactobacillus acidophilus are the 0.3% of earthworm powder weight, and the addition of bacillus subtilis is
The 0.1% of earthworm powder weight.
Embodiment 3
A kind of yellow-feather broiler mixed feed, is calculated according to percetage by weight, including following raw material is made:
500 parts of corn, 100 parts of dregs of beans, 80 parts of rice bran meal, embodiment 1 20 parts of 90 parts of earthworm tunning, vegetable oil,
10 parts of 70 parts of peanut meal, 1 part of compound amino acid, 2 parts of complex enzyme, 1 part of trace element, 1 part of phytase and calcium monohydrogen phosphate.
Compound amino acid is methionine, threonine, the mixture with lysine.
Complex enzyme is combined by cellulase, 1,4 beta-glucanase, zytase and alpha-amylase and carrier shell powder.
Trace element combines by ferrous sulfate, zinc sulfate, copper sulphate, manganese sulfate with calcium iodate and as the stone flour of carrier
Form.
